Event & Visitor Overview – Butler Beauty School
Butler Beauty School primarily hosts vocational cosmetology and esthetician training, student-run client clinics, continuing-education workshops, skills assessments, and occasional product demonstrations or instructor-led seminars. Typical visitors are trade students in multi-term programs, instructors and examiners, community clients booking salon services at reduced clinic rates, and prospective students attending open-house style sessions. The venue’s use centers on hands-on skills training and required practical assessments, so visits are usually organized around class schedules, clinic appointments, and certification or continuing-education dates rather than informal walk-ins.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
Class days follow a predictable training cadence with block schedules that mix classroom instruction and supervised hands-on practice. Mornings often begin with theory or demonstrations, then shift into clinic hours where students rotate through stations and serve scheduled clients; instructors circulate to observe and coach. Evenings and some weekend slots accommodate working students and short workshops, producing concentrated flows at start and end times. Breaks, station turnover, and cleanup create short downtimes between service blocks, while assessment or exam days tend to be full-day affairs with longer waits and more structured observation periods.
